Breathwork Akademy Calm: Max Lowenstein Review
The Breathwork Akademy Calm is Max Lowenstein's $29/month Skool membership. Review its daily coaching, live sessions and health-claim caveats.

The Breathwork Akademy: Calm is Max Lowenstein's private Skool community built around short guided breathing practices, daily answers, weekly live sessions and an expanding course library. The freshest public snapshot reviewed on 11 September 2026 showed 380 members, one admin, four reviews averaging 5.0 and a seven-day trial followed by $29 per month.

Who is Max Lowenstein?
Max Lowenstein is the founder named on The Breathwork Akademy page and uses the Skool handle @healingmotions. The offer attributes 23 years of experience, hundreds of thousands of followers and hundreds of millions of views to him. Those audience and experience figures were not independently audited for this review.

What does The Breathwork Akademy include?
The offer combines a low-friction daily practice with coaching and a growing library. Its headline language goes further, making claims about anxiety, sleep and the nervous system that prospective members should discuss with a qualified clinician when relevant.

The Breathwork Akademy vs other options
| Option | Best for | Main trade-off |
|---|---|---|
| The Breathwork Akademy | People wanting a guided routine and live community | Strong health claims need independent scrutiny |
| Licensed therapist | Assessment and evidence-based mental-health care | Not a craft-style practice community |
| Respiratory clinician | Symptoms involving breathing or lung function | Focuses medical evaluation, not membership accountability |
| Meditation app | Low-cost guided relaxation | Limited live personalization |
| Local breathwork class | In-person facilitation and observation | Schedule, method and instructor quality vary |
The safest buying decision starts with scope. Use breathwork as a wellbeing practice, not a guaranteed treatment. Ask what techniques are taught, which contraindications are screened, how facilitators respond to adverse reactions and whether refunds exclude any conditions.

The formula you can copy
Make the first habit small. A short daily practice is easier to try than an open-ended transformation program. That is a useful community positioning technique when the promise stays proportionate.
Combine asynchronous and live support. A library handles repeatable instruction, while weekly sessions and daily answers address member-specific friction. That cadence can improve community engagement.
Use a challenge as onboarding, not medical proof. Seven days can help someone test format and consistency, but it cannot establish universal health outcomes. Pair the experience with transparent pricing and clear safety boundaries.
The builder lesson: wellness communities build more durable trust when they pair an approachable habit with explicit contraindications and avoid presenting member experiences as universal treatment evidence.

Can breathwork treat anxiety or insomnia?
This article does not establish that. Marketing claims and testimonials are not medical evidence or a replacement for professional care.
What does membership include?
The page lists daily coaching, weekly live sessions, on-demand practices, premium courses and new material added weekly.
Who should seek medical advice first?
Anyone with relevant cardiovascular, respiratory, neurological, pregnancy or mental-health concerns should ask a qualified clinician before intensive breathwork.
